Output 807693015f23a427a6954612e1175e7ebbcf3e3750981fad0b1e6e4310b89d00:24

value
2135738
script pubkey
OP_0 OP_PUSHBYTES_20 4106f31cccb81abdb6fde835c7f5107ce0059a12
address
bc1qgyr0x8xvhqdtmdhaaq6u0ags0nsqtxsj6xxh0m
transaction
807693015f23a427a6954612e1175e7ebbcf3e3750981fad0b1e6e4310b89d00
spent
true